goat3d
diff src/goat3d.h @ 88:7941e89798e5
selections
author | John Tsiombikas <nuclear@member.fsf.org> |
---|---|
date | Thu, 15 May 2014 06:52:01 +0300 |
parents | 70b7c41a4f17 |
children | da100bf13f7f |
line diff
1.1 --- a/src/goat3d.h Wed May 14 18:28:38 2014 +0300 1.2 +++ b/src/goat3d.h Thu May 15 06:52:01 2014 +0300 1.3 @@ -213,6 +213,8 @@ 1.4 GOAT3DAPI void goat3d_color3f(float x, float y, float z); 1.5 GOAT3DAPI void goat3d_color4f(float x, float y, float z, float w); 1.6 1.7 +GOAT3DAPI void goat3d_get_mesh_bounds(const struct goat3d_mesh *mesh, float *bmin, float *bmax); 1.8 + 1.9 /* lights */ 1.10 GOAT3DAPI void goat3d_add_light(struct goat3d *g, struct goat3d_light *lt); 1.11 GOAT3DAPI int goat3d_get_light_count(struct goat3d *g); 1.12 @@ -278,6 +280,8 @@ 1.13 1.14 GOAT3DAPI void goat3d_get_node_matrix(const struct goat3d_node *node, float *matrix, long tmsec); 1.15 1.16 +GOAT3DAPI void goat3d_get_node_bounds(const struct goat3d_node *node, float *bmin, float *bmax); 1.17 + 1.18 #ifdef __cplusplus 1.19 } 1.20 #endif